    Subject[PATCH v11 00/10] Add Rockchip SFC(serial flash controller) support
    Date


    Changes in v11:
    - The tx is set to 1 for Odroid Go Advance device

    Changes in v10:
    - Fix dma transfer logic

    Changes in v9:
    - Separate DMA IRQ setting and wait_completion from DMA fifo transfer
    function to make dma_status_poll be possible(Which I will implement
    in u-boot)
    - Add SFC Kconfig detail comment
    - Separate FDT binding docs and includes from rk3036 sfc_hclk patch
    - Separate FDT binding docs and includes from rk3036 sfc_hclk patch

    Changes in v8:
    - Fix indent 4 to 2 in yaml

    Changes in v7:
    - Fix up the sclk_sfc parent error in rk3036
    - Unify to "rockchip,sfc" compatible id because all the feature update
    will have a new IP version, so the driver is used for the SFC IP in
    all SoCs
    - Change to use node "sfc" to name the SFC pinctrl group
    - Add subnode reg property check
    - Add rockchip_sfc_adjust_op_size to workaround in CMD + DUMMY case
    - Limit max_iosize to 32KB

    Changes in v6:
    - Add support in device trees for rv1126(Declared in series 5 but not
    submitted)
    - Change to use "clk_sfc" "hclk_sfc" as clock lable, since it does not
    affect interpretation and has been widely used
    - Support sfc tx_dual, tx_quad(Declared in series 5 but not submitted)
    - Simplify the code, such as remove "rockchip_sfc_register_all"(Declared
    in series 5 but not submitted)
    - Support SFC ver4 ver5(Declared in series 5 but not submitted)
    - Add author Chris Morgan and Jon Lin to spi-rockchip-sfc.c
    - Change to use devm_spi_alloc_master and spi_unregister_master

    Changes in v5:
    - Add support in device trees for rv1126
    - Support sfc tx_dual, tx_quad
    - Simplify the code, such as remove "rockchip_sfc_register_all"
    - Support SFC ver4 ver5

    Changes in v4:
    - Changing patch back to an "RFC". An engineer from Rockchip
    reached out to me to let me know they are working on this patch for
    upstream, I am submitting this v4 for the community to see however
    I expect Jon Lin (jon.lin@rock-chips.com) will submit new patches
    soon and these are the ones we should pursue for mainlining. Jon's
    patch series should include support for more hardware than this
    series.
    - Clean up documentation more and ensure it is correct per
    make dt_binding_check.
    - Add support in device trees for rk3036, rk3308, and rv1108.
    - Add ahb clock (hclk_sfc) support for rk3036.
    - Change rockchip_sfc_wait_fifo_ready() to use a switch statement.
    - Change IRQ code to only mark IRQ as handled if it handles the
    specific IRQ (DMA transfer finish) it is supposed to handle.

    Changes in v3:
    - Changed the name of the clocks to sfc/ahb (from clk-sfc/clk-hsfc).
    - Changed the compatible string from rockchip,sfc to
    rockchip,rk3036-sfc. A quick glance at the datasheets suggests this
    driver should work for the PX30, RK180x, RK3036, RK312x, RK3308 and
    RV1108 SoCs, and possibly more. However, I am currently only able
    to test this on a PX30 (an RK3326). The technical reference manuals
    appear to list the same registers for each device.
    - Corrected devicetree documentation for formatting and to note these
    changes.
    - Replaced the maintainer with Heiko Stuebner and myself, as we will
    take ownership of this going forward.
    - Noted that the device (per the reference manual) supports 4 CS, but
    I am only able to test a single CS (CS 0).
    - Reordered patches to comply with upstream rules.

    Changes in v2:
    - Reimplemented driver using spi-mem subsystem.
    - Removed power management code as I couldn't get it working properly.
    - Added device tree bindings for Odroid Go Advance.

    Changes in v1:
    hanges made in this new series versus the v8 of the old series:
    - Added function to read spi-rx-bus-width from device tree, in the
    event that the SPI chip supports 4x mode but only has 2 pins
    wired (such as the Odroid Go Advance).
    - Changed device tree documentation from txt to yaml format.
    - Made "reset" message a dev_dbg from a dev_info.
    - Changed read and write fifo functions to remove redundant checks.
    - Changed the write and read from relaxed to non-relaxed when
    starting the DMA transfer or reading the DMA IRQ.
    - Changed from dma_coerce_mask_and_coherent to just
    dma_set_mask_and_coherent.
    - Changed name of get_if_type to rockchip_sfc_get_if_type.
